Poly phenylene vinylene nanoparticles

The synthesis of poly(phenylene vinylene) (PPV) nanoparticles using ADMET has also been reported [47]. In this case, an aqueous emulsion polymerization was utilized, such that particle sizes ranging from 200 to 300 nm were observed. The molecular weights of the PPVs in this case were rather low (on the order of 1 kDa), but this was attributed to slow rates of reaction, rather than to the sensitivity of the catalyst species towards aqueous conditions. Despite having low molecular weights, these polymers demonstrated absorption and photoluminescence data that were consistent with those of previously reported PPVs. Hybrid films of ZnO nanoparticles and poly[2-methoxy - 5 - (3, 7 -dimethyloctyloxyl) -1,4-phenylene vinylene] (MDMO-PPV) have been characterized as a model hybrid bulk heterojunction photovoltaic cell [145]. [Pg.88]
